Chrysanthemum parthenium

[FEVERFEW]

 $4.65 

Category: Potted Plants
Longevity: HP (zones 4 to 9)
Lighting Conditions: PS-FS
Average Height: 18 inches
Uses: M O R

Repellent to insects, it requires little care if provided with rich, well-drained soil. An easy, showy perennial with yellow-centered, white-petaled, daisy-like flowers. Tea made from the leaves is used to treat arthritis, fevers, colds, and as a tonic. The root contains pyrethrin, a powerful insecticide; may cause dermatitis in some people. Research is proving that the leaves are effective in controlling migraine headaches, especially when used with leaves of Laurus nobilis. Reseeds.
